WebThrombocytosis (pronounced “throm-boe-sie-TOE-sis”) is having too many platelets in your blood. Platelets are blood cells that stop bleeding by sticking together to form a clot. WebA high platelet count can cause too much clotting in your blood vessels. Or it can cause too much bleeding if the platelets interfere with clotting. It could be a sign of: Immune system problems. Infections. Problems with the genes that control platelet production. Some cancers. Results. 9 can i give my dog buffered aspirin for painWebThrombocytopenia, defined as a platelet count of less than 150 × 10 9 /L, is common and occurs in 7–12% of pregnancies at the time of delivery 2 3. Thrombocytopenia can result from a variety of physiologic or pathologic conditions, several of which are unique to pregnancy.
